Best Seoul Pork Rib (Yangnyeom Galbi) Restaurants to Try

A curated list of Seoul's smoky, old-school pork rib restaurants where seasoned galbi and charcoal flavor take center stage.

Yangnyeom galbi (seasoned pork ribs) is a familiar order, but finding a restaurant that gets the balance right is trickier than it sounds. Sauce that's too sweet gets tiring fast, uneven heat chars the surface, and thin cuts lose their texture.

This list rounds up Seoul spots that combine charcoal aroma, old-school atmosphere, and layouts that work for family meals or work dinners. Hours and prices can change, so it's worth confirming before you go.

01

Buil Sutbul Galbi

A short walk from Yeongdeungpo Station, this spot is a go-to name when Seoulites talk about pork rib restaurants in the area. The meat is heavily marinated and grilled over charcoal, delivering the familiar sweet-and-salty flavor most people expect from yangnyeom galbi. Its busy, old-school dining room adds to the appeal for anyone who enjoys a lively atmosphere.
02

Jobakjip Main Branch

One of the more recognized names for pork ribs in the Mapo area. The sauce leans sweet and the overall meal is well-rounded, making it a solid pick for family dinners or group gatherings. It also works well if you want to follow the grilled ribs with a proper meal course.
03

Gyeongsangdo-jip

Tucked into Euljiro's alley scene, this restaurant serves charcoal-grilled pork ribs pre-cooked and ready to eat. The smoky, sweet marinade pairs naturally with drinks, and the setting favors a lively, no-frills vibe over polished dining. Since it's an old-school spot, wait times and seating can be unpredictable, so it helps to go with some flexibility in your schedule.
04

Yongma Galbi

A neighborhood restaurant in Jungnang-gu that keeps things simple, focusing on the classic taste of seasoned pork ribs rather than a flashy menu. It suits anyone looking for an unpretentious, casual meal close to home, whether that's a family dinner or a low-key gathering.
05

Yeongdong Sammi Sutbul Galbi

Located in Nonhyeon-dong, this restaurant serves pork ribs alongside LA-style short ribs and beef short ribs, giving groups with different preferences more to choose from. It works well for after-work dinners or gatherings in the Gangnam area.
06

Useong Galbi

Near Yaksu and Sindang-dong, this restaurant pairs seasoned pork ribs with grilled pork skin (kkopdegi), a combination that suits a drinking-focused evening. Its modest, old-school setting appeals to anyone who prefers a low-key neighborhood spot.
07

Ulsan Sutbul Galbi

In the Songpa area, this restaurant keeps its seasoning less sweet than some competitors, aiming for balance between the marinade and the meat itself. That makes it a reasonable pick for family meals where not everyone wants an overly sweet sauce. Checking parking and reservation availability ahead of time is worthwhile.
08

Cheongsujang

A long-running restaurant in the Jeongneung area that leans on consistency rather than trend-chasing. It suits diners who prefer a steady, familiar version of seasoned pork ribs, including family meals with parents.

Frequently asked questions

What should I look for when picking an old-school pork rib restaurant in Seoul?

Pay attention to the balance between sweetness and smoky char, the thickness of the meat, and the side dishes. Old-school restaurants often turn tables quickly and may have a wait, so it helps to visit with some flexibility.

Which of these restaurants work well for a family dinner?

Places with a well-rounded menu that carries through to a full meal tend to be the safer choice, such as Jobakjip Main Branch or Cheongsujang.

Could the hours or prices differ from what's listed here?

Yes. Old-school restaurants often change their hours or prices without much notice, so it's a good idea to check by phone or a map app shortly before visiting.
